NetSpeedMonitor: NetSpeedMonitor is a free open source internet speed monitoring tool for Windows. It allows you to track your network speeds and usage over time. Useful for diagnosing connectivity issues.

Where Is It?: Where Is It? is a file search utility for Windows that allows you to easily locate files and folders on your computer or network drives. It has an intuitive interface and advanced search features like regex and file contents search.

Key Features Comparison

NetSpeedMonitor
NetSpeedMonitor Features
  • Real-time monitoring of network speed
  • Graphical display of network usage over time
  • Ability to log network speeds for diagnostics
  • Alerts for network speed thresholds
  • Lightweight and resource friendly
Where Is It?
Where Is It? Features
  • Intuitive interface
  • Advanced search capabilities
  • Regex support
  • File contents search
  • Search across network drives

Pros & Cons Analysis

NetSpeedMonitor
NetSpeedMonitor

Pros

  • Free and open source
  • Simple and easy to use
  • Provides useful connectivity diagnostics
  • Customizable logging and alerts
  • Low resource usage

Cons

  • Limited to Windows platform
  • No advanced reporting features
  • Basic interface lacks polish
  • Alerts could be more configurable
Where Is It?
Where Is It?

Pros

  • Fast and easy to use
  • Powerful search features
  • Finds files quickly
  • Great for finding misplaced files
  • Can search offline files

Cons

  • Requires indexing before searching
  • Uses a good amount of RAM
  • No cloud sync
  • Limited customization options
